#29c58c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#29c58c is composed of 16.1% red, 77.3%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.9%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 158.1 degrees, a saturation of 65.5% and a lightness of 46.7%. #29c58c color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ffff with #008b19.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#29c58c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#29c58c has RGB values of R:41, G:197,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 2737548.

Shades and Tints of #29c58c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000202 is the darkest color, while #f1fc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#29c58c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727c78 is the less saturated color, while #04ea96 is the most saturated one.
